Man Sentenced to 15 Years for Rape of a Woman

Mohanoe Jantjie Tshabalala has been sentenced to 15 years of direct imprisonment for the rape of a 35-year-old woman from Mautse. The sentence was delivered on 20 March 2026 in the Ficksburg Regional Court.

The case was investigated by Detective Warrant Officer Sibongile Valashiya of the Bethlehem Family Violence, Child Protection and Sexual Offences (FCS) Unit. Mr Vusi Nhlapo prosecuted the matter, and Mr Matshaya presided.

The offence occurred on 1 September 2024. At approximately 04:00, the victim was walking home with a friend from a tavern when the accused confronted them and assaulted both individuals. The friend escaped, leaving the victim alone with Tshabalala, who then raped her.

Evidence collected at the scene was submitted for forensic analysis. The accused was initially arrested and later released pending DNA results. Following a positive DNA match, a warrant of arrest was issued, and he was re-arrested.

The South African Police Service stated that crimes against women and children will not be tolerated and that perpetrators will be pursued until justice prevails.
